新闻中心

怎么用HTML插入下拉选择框_HTML select与option标签使用

2025-10-19
浏览次数:
返回列表
使用select和option标签可创建下拉框,通过value传递数据,selected设置默认项,disabled隐藏提示项,multiple支持多选,name用于表单提交识别,提升交互与数据准确性。

怎么用html插入下拉选择框_html select与option标签使用

在HTML中插入下拉选择框,主要使用 selectoption 标签。通过这两个标签的配合,可以创建用户可从中选择一项或多项的下拉菜单。

基本语法结构

使用 定义下拉框容器,内部用多个 表示可选项。

示例:

<select>
  <option value="beijing">北京</option>
  <option value="shanghai">上海</option>
  <option value="guangzhou">广州</option>
</select>

用户打开下拉框后,可以看到“北京”“上海”“广州”三个选项,提交表单时会发送对应 value 值。

设置默认选中项

给某个 option 添加 selected 属性,可以让该选项默认被选中。

例如,默认选中“上海”:

<option value="shanghai" selected>上海</option>

页面加载时,“上海”会显示在下拉框中作为当前选择。

添加提示文字与禁用选项

可在第一个 option 中添加提示信息,并使用 disabledhidden 防止被选中。

Visla Visla

AI视频生成器,快速轻松地将您的想法转化为视觉上令人惊叹的视频。

Visla 100 查看详情 Visla

常见做法:

<option value="" disabled hidden>请选择城市</option>

这样用户必须主动选择一个有效值,避免误提交空选项。

支持多选与命名表单字段

select 添加 name 属性,以便表单提交时识别数据。

若允许选择多个选项,加上 multiple 属性:

<select name="cities" multiple>
  <option value="beijing">北京</option>
  <option value="shanghai">上海</option>
  <option value="shenzhen">深圳</option>
</select>

用户按住 Ctrl(或 Command)可多选,提交时以数组形式发送所选 value。

基本上就这些。select 和 option 标签简单但实用,是构建表单不可或缺的一部分。注意设置 value 和 name,合理使用 selected 和 disabled,能提升用户体验和数据准确性。

以上就是怎么用HTML插入下拉选择框_HTML select与option标签使用的详细内容,更多请关注其它相关文章!


# html  # 网页设计与网站建设课程  # 韶关市专注网站建设  # 保定谷歌seo公司电话  # 乌海网站首页推广  # thinkphp5 seo  # 下城区seo网站  # 河北区网站推广公司  # 武昌哪里有网站建设  # 虚拟指定营销策略和推广  # 游戏开发  # 转换工具  # 使用技巧  # 广州  # 下拉框  # 多个  # 多选  # 北京  # 表单  # 表单提交  # 上海  # ai  # html5  # 能源信息网站建设 


相关栏目: 【 科技资讯46185 】 【 网络学院92790


相关推荐: 邮政快递单号查询入口 邮政快递物流信息在线查询入口  一加 Nord 5 隐私权限异常_一加 Nord 5 系统安全优化  NetBeans Ant项目:自动化将资源文件复制到dist目录的教程  理解J*aScript Promise的微任务队列与执行顺序  探索高级语言到C/C++的转译路径:以Go为例及内存管理策略  composer的"require-dev"部分是用来做什么的?  小米14应用无法联网原因分析_小米14网络权限修复  海棠账号登录入口_登录海棠账户同步阅读记录  C++如何实现一个装饰器模式_C++设计模式之动态地给对象添加额外职责  谷歌邮箱注册显示错误Gmail服务器异常与延迟处理  192.168.1.1管理中心入口 192.168.1.1路由器网页设置平台  Log4j Console Appender性能瓶颈与高并发优化策略  Sublime Text怎么显示空格和制表符_Sublime显示不可见字符设置  电脑安装程序提示“错误1722”怎么办_Windows Installer服务问题解决【教程】  在命令行怎么运行html项目_命令行运行html项目方法【教程】  处理嵌套交互式控件:前端可访问性指南  反效果?《战地6》免费试玩开启后玩家数不升反降  php源码怎么在电脑上测试_电脑测试php源码方法步骤【教程】  Win11如何使用Windows Sandbox Win11沙盒功能开启与使用教程【详解】  J*aScript动态修改指定div内所有a标签样式指南  126邮箱手机版登录官网2026_126手机邮箱免费入口最新  淘宝支付提示失败如何解决 淘宝支付流程优化方法  抓大鹅解压小游戏 抓大鹅摸鱼解压入口  Golang如何处理RPC请求负载均衡_Golang RPC请求负载均衡策略与实践  css元素hover动画延迟生效怎么办_使用animation-delay调整触发时间  树莓派传感器触发:通过Twilio API发送WhatsApp消息教程  Python中高效且防溢出的双曲正弦计算:基于对数空间的优化策略  163邮箱网页版入口导航平台 163邮箱网页版登录入口官网导航  Python Socket多播通信中指定源IP地址的实践指南  在J*a中如何捕获IndexOutOfBoundsException_索引越界异常防护方法说明  双系统安装时,如何设置默认启动系统? msconfig命令了解一下!  Flexbox布局实践:实现粘性导航栏与底部固定页脚  c++中的std::basic_string的SSO优化_c++短字符串优化深度解析  抖音怎么赚钱_抖音创作者变现方法与途径指南  outlook中文官网入口地址 outlook官方中文版直达首页链接  微信网页版官方入口教程 微信网页版网页版快速登录步骤  GemBox Document HTML转PDF垂直文本渲染问题及解决方案  J*aScript数组对象转换:按指定键分组与值收集  C++如何生成随机数_C++ random库使用方法与范围设置  PySpark中高效提取字符串右侧可变长度数字:使用regexp_extract  荣耀Play7T运行卡顿解决_荣耀Play7T性能优化  在Qt QML中通过Python字典动态更新TextEdit内容的教程  使用J*aScript检测输入元素是否包含在特定类中  新三国志曹操传110级星符试炼夏侯渊极难攻略  Win10如何恢复误删的快捷方式_Win10重建常用软件快捷方式  vivo浏览器怎么扫描二维码 vivo浏览器内置扫一扫功能使用方法  Node.js CSV 数据处理:基于字段空值条件过滤整条记录的策略  Golang如何使用net/url解析URL_Golang URL解析与处理方法  抓大鹅无需下载版 抓大鹅秒玩版入口  特斯拉自动驾驶房车计划曝光 原型车将于2027年亮相 

搜索